The speed at which a cell produces proteins is crucial for whether it divides, specializes, or retains its stem cell properties. 🧬 A international team led by Stefan Stricker @bmc-lmu.bsky.social has shown for the first time that the amount of ribosomal RNA (rRNA) directly regulates these processes.

New CRISPR method makes it possible to control protein production in cells

A new study led by LMU biomedical scientist Stefan Stricker increases protein production in a targeted manner – with new insights into stem cell biology and disease-relevant processes.

LMU projects contribute to second funding period of Collaborative Research Centre TRR332

Markus Sperandio and Daniela Maier-Begandt investigate how neutrophils are guided from the bloodstream into inflamed tissue and how bacterial pathogens manipulate neutrophil function.
